Description Petr Matousek 2013-12-10 06:48:14 UTC
By default, remote-viewer first connects to insecure port and only switches to TLS when server requests/requires it when native spice client invocation method is used. An attacker on client local machine or on the router on the way can easily set up a MITM Evil Proxy that would pretend to be endpoint of plaintext port from client POV and it would act as a regular client to the server.
